Considerations for Careful Application
Designers should be mindful when using this asset in small sizes or crowded layouts. The intricate, playful lettering of "JUST a GIRL LOVe FALL" may lose readability when scaled down significantly, impacting visual hierarchy. It may clash in environments requiring very clean, minimalist branding or on complex backgrounds. It is not naturally suited for professional corporate materials where a more neutral tone is required. Always test it on both light and dark backgrounds to ensure contrast remains sufficient for legibility.

Practical Designer Notes Before Client Use
Before committing this asset to a client project, conduct due diligence. First, preview it at both very small and large sizes to gauge readability limits. Test it in black and white to understand its form without color. Place it on real mockups—a tumbler, a t-shirt, a flyer—to see how it interacts with other design elements. Crucially, inspect the provided file formats: the PNG transparency for overlay use, and the SVG for vector editability, allowing you to adjust colors or separate elements if the commercial license permits.
Compare its handwritten display font style against other typography in the project; it may pair well with a simple sans-serif for body text but clash with another script font. Finally, and most importantly, explicitly confirm the commercial licensing terms. As a digital product intended for crafts and graphics, ensure its license covers your specific use case—whether for print-on-demand, digital ads, or physical product labels—to protect your client and your practice.
